?My war ended before I ever put on a uniform; I was on active duty all my time at school; I killed my enemy there.? This quote by Gene Forrester, a character in John Knowle?s novel A Separate Peace, depicts Gene?s personal turmoil during his high school years. Throughout the entire novel Gene had an emotional quest for his own separate peace. He endured test after test of his inner strength while attending the Devon Academy. Gene Forrester had many serious occurrences during his high school years, some of which have scarred him for life. Gene attended the Devon Academy in New England during the start of World War II. However, Gene had his own war and enemies to fight, not the enemy Nazis. Gene?s greatest competitor and enemy ended up as his best friend Phineas.
